Ingredients

  • 400 g Whole Wheat Flour (high‑protein whole wheat flour)
  • 10 g Fresh Brewer's Yeast (active fresh yeast, kept refrigerated)
  • 1 tsp Salt (fine sea salt)
  • 300 ml Warm Water (about 38 °C, warm to the touch)
  • 2 tbsp Extra Virgin Olive Oil (adds softness and flavor)
  • 2 tbsp Semolina (for dusting the baking sheet)

Instructions

  1. Mix Dry Ingredients

    In a large mixing bowl combine the whole wheat flour, salt, and crumbled fresh brewer's yeast.

    Time: PT5M

  2. Add Water and Blend

    Pour the warm water over the dry mixture and blend with a hand mixer or wooden spoon for about 1 minute until a shaggy dough forms.

    Time: PT2M

  3. Incorporate Olive Oil and Knead

    Add the olive oil and knead the dough in the bowl (or on a lightly floured surface) for 8‑10 minutes until smooth and elastic.

    Time: PT10M

  4. First Proof

    Cover the bowl with a kitchen towel and place it in a warm spot (around 30 °C) for 1 hour, or until the dough has doubled in size.

    Time: PT1H

  5. Shape the Loaf

    Punch down the risen dough, shape it into a loaf or a round boule, and place it on a baking sheet lightly dusted with semolina.

    Time: PT10M

  6. Second Proof

    Cover the shaped dough again and let it rest for 15‑20 minutes until slightly puffed.

    Time: PT20M

  7. Preheat Oven

    While the dough is on its second rise, preheat the oven to 180 °C (350 °F).

    Time: PT10M

    Temperature: 180°C

  8. Bake

    Bake the bread for 30‑35 minutes, until the crust is golden and the loaf sounds hollow when tapped on the bottom.

    Time: PT35M

    Temperature: 180°C

  9. Cool

    Remove the bread from the oven, transfer to a cooling rack and let it cool for at least 10 minutes before slicing.

    Time: PT10M

Safety Warnings

  • Do not use water hotter than 45 °C; it can kill the yeast.
  • Handle the hot baking sheet with oven mitts to avoid burns.

Q

What are the most common mistakes to avoid when making soft whole wheat bread at home?

A

Common errors include using water that is too hot (which kills the yeast), under‑kneading the dough, and not allowing enough time for the first rise. Each of these can lead to a dense, flat loaf.

technical
Q

Why does this soft whole wheat bread recipe use fresh brewer's yeast instead of instant dry yeast?

A

Fresh brewer's yeast provides a milder flavor and a quicker rise in warm doughs, which helps keep the crumb soft. Instant dry yeast can be used, but the timing and quantity need adjustment.

technical
Q

Can I make soft whole wheat bread ahead of time and how should I store it?

A

Yes, you can bake the loaf a day ahead and store it in an airtight container at room temperature. For longer storage, slice and freeze the bread; reheat slices in a toaster or oven before serving.

technical
